• CMS rates this facility 2/5 stars (below average)
• Has 82 certified beds with an average of 76.1 residents per day (93% occupancy)
• Last health inspection found 3 deficiencies (inspected Nov 25, 2024)
• No fines on record
• Total nursing staff: 3.61 hours per resident per day
• Staff turnover rate: 34.8%
• Part of the Twin Rivers Health & Rehabilitation chain (11 facilities)
Woodbury Health and Rehabilitation Center is a 2-star Medicare and Medicaid certified nursing home in Woodbury, Tennessee with 82 certified beds. It has been operating since 2002. The facility scored below average compared to Tennessee facilities.
